Random Forest Classifier: Basic Principles and Applications

#artificialintelligence 

Predicting customer behavior, consumer demand or stock price fluctuations, identifying fraud, and diagnosing patients -- these are some of the popular applications of the random forest (RF) algorithm. Used for classification and regression tasks, it can significantly enhance the efficiency of business processes and scientific research. This blog post will cover the random forest algorithm, its operating principles, capabilities and limitations, and real-world applications. A random forest is a supervised machine learning algorithm in which the calculations of numerous decision trees are combined to produce one final result. It's popular because it is simple yet effective. Random forest is an ensemble method -- a technique where we take many base-level models and combine them to get improved results.
